It is theoretically possible for an evap line to start showing within an hour. They show as the stick dries. They usually are gray though, not the color the line is supposed to be.

Since the line is light, you waited too long, and your DH doesn't see it at all, I can't give any advice other than this: get thee to a Dollar Tree and pick up some of their $1 tests. They work just as well as the expensive ones (I should know, I've taken hundreds of them - LOL) and you can test again TODAY.

If the line you see is a "real" line, your HcG is strong enough to show positive and is only going up, so another test is your key to know.

If the line is the same colour as the control line and not grey then it is more than likely NOT a evap. Evaps are grey and hard to see to see a evap you need to sometimes twist and squint lol. Sometimes a sensitive test can detect early pregnancy and if your not due on yet then this could be the reason why your getting a very faint line. I would keep testing just to be sure. Its also possible that ladies detect whats called a chemical pregnancy. Like myself i have had 3 and detected them by testing earlier with sensitive tests. It shows a very faint coloured line which then ends up bfn if we never tested earlier we would not know about chemicals Thats why its always best to test near af date just to be sure.
